Scientists race to find best muscle recovery for athletes

NCT ID NCT07387276

Summary

This study aims to find which muscle recovery technique works best for professional athletes after intense exercise. Researchers will test six different methods on 20 healthy basketball and endurance athletes to see which one most effectively reduces muscle pain and helps restore strength. The study will measure muscle oxygen levels, temperature, pain sensitivity, and strength to compare the immediate effects of each recovery approach.
